Transaction 571f04568315629233332feaf01ffbaae65b94da51a91774e640e759058e7140

1 Input
2 Outputs
  • 571f04568315629233332feaf01ffbaae65b94da51a91774e640e759058e7140:0
  • value  48931095
    address  2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k
  • 571f04568315629233332feaf01ffbaae65b94da51a91774e640e759058e7140:1
  • value  564902
    address  mwRQ68rU4eMCZo8BNcjfGfSRLiHd5f9zPn